Jim Ricchiuti - Needham & Co.
I was wondering if you could comment on pricing in the quarter, just given what we saw in margins. Are you seeing any unusual pricing pressure in either PCB or flat panel?
Amichai Steimberg
Pricing pressure not on the PCB, seen PCB both on AOR and directing imaging pricing is not an issue right now. We do see some pricing pressures on some of the FPD product, yes.

Jim Ricchiuti - Needham & Co.
Can you talk a little bit about bookings in flat panel in the quarter and how you see bookings in Q4? I know you don’t specifically give bookings, but maybe you could just talk qualitatively.
Amichai Steimberg
There was no big change in the trend of booking in the third quarter compared to this first and the second quarter. We believe that the change will materialize whoever will take in terms of new bookings during the fourth quarter.
Jim Ricchiuti - Needham & Co.
Is Q1 also a quarter where you expect to see increased order activity?
Amichai Steimberg
Yes. The other trends of order flow or increasing order flow, we believe should start as we speak, and will go somewhere to the summer of 2010. I’m talking about new orders flow that the deliveries and revenue is of course is a different story.
Jim Ricchiuti - Needham & Co.
Last question, do you think the flat panel business from a revenue standpoint would be up next year? You have some visibility. What’s your sense?
Amichai Steimberg
We have some visibility as you stated and based on some visibility we believe next year will be stronger than 2009.
